Hibernate QuerySyntaxException是Hibernate框架中的一个异常类,用于表示在执行Hibernate查询时发生的语法错误。
Hibernate是一个开源的对象关系映射(ORM)框架,它提供了一种将Java对象映射到关系数据库中的机制。通过Hibernate,开发人员可以使用面向对象的方式来操作数据库,而不需要直接编写SQL语句。
在Hibernate中,使用HQL(Hibernate Query Language)进行查询操作。HQL是一种面向对象的查询语言,类似于SQL,但是使用实体类和属性名来代替表名和列名。当在使用HQL进行查询时,如果语法错误,就会抛出Hibernate QuerySyntaxException异常。
该异常通常是由以下原因引起的:
对于解决Hibernate QuerySyntaxException异常,可以采取以下步骤:
腾讯云提供了一系列与云计算相关的产品,其中包括数据库、服务器、人工智能等。具体推荐的腾讯云产品和产品介绍链接地址如下:
以上是对于Hibernate QuerySyntaxException的解释和相关推荐的腾讯云产品。希望能对您有所帮助。
云+社区技术沙龙[第14期]
API网关系列直播
云原生正发声
云+社区技术沙龙[第17期]
T-Day
Elastic 中国开发者大会
Elastic 中国开发者大会
技术创作101训练营
腾讯位置服务技术沙龙
DBTalk技术分享会
领取专属 10元无门槛券
手把手带您无忧上云